Obama has made these solemn promises on his webiste:

a.. Reinstate PAYGO Rules: Obama and Biden believe that a critical step in
restoring fiscal discipline is enforcing pay-as-you-go (PAYGO) budgeting
rules which require new spending commitments or tax changes to be paid for
by cuts to other programs or new revenue.

a.. Cut Pork Barrel Spending: Obama introduced and passed bipartisan
legislation that would require more disclosure and transparency for
special-interest earmarks. Obama and Biden believe that spending that cannot
withstand public scrutiny cannot be justified. Obama and Biden will slash
earmarks to no greater than year 1994 levels and ensure all spending
decisions are open to the public.

a.. Make Government Spending More Accountable and Efficient: Obama and Biden
will ensure that federal contracts over $25,000 are competitively bid. Obama
and Biden will also increase the efficiency of government programs through
better use of technology, stronger management that demands accountability
and by leveraging the government's high-volume purchasing power to get lower
prices.
a.. End Wasteful Government Spending: Obama and Biden will stop funding
wasteful, obsolete federal government programs that make no financial sense.
Obama and Biden have called for an end to subsidies for oil and gas
companies that are enjoying record profits, as well as the elimination of
subsidies to the private student loan industry which has repeatedly used
unethical business practices. Obama and Biden will also tackle wasteful
spending in the Medicare program.

a.. PAYGO: Obama voted in 2005, 2006, and 2007 to reinstate pay-as-you-go
(PAYGO) federal budget rules.
b.. No-Bid Contracts: Obama has introduced and helped pass bipartisan
legislation to limit the abuse of no-bid federal contracts.
c.. Against Raising the Federal Debt Limit: In 2006, Obama voted against
misguided Republican efforts to raise the statutory debt limit at the same
time the Republicans were pushing through massive debt-financed tax cuts for
the wealthy.
